Abstract

The high frequency leakage-proof door structure is made by the steps of : bending the periphery of the door plate(11) to install a high frequency absorber in an opening(21) between a door plate(11) and a door screen(12); extending bent parts(11a) to close the opening(21), forming grooves(22) in the periphery of the door screen, and filling liquid phase high frequency absorber in the grooves, thereby achieving a low-cost production.

본 발명은 전자렌지의 도어에 고주파 흡수체를 설치하여 누설되는 고주파를 흡수토록 구성함에 있어서 고주파 흡수체의 설치가 간편하면서도 상당한 원자재비를 절감할 수 있도록 한 발명에 관한 것이다.The present invention relates to an invention in which a high frequency absorber is installed in a door of a microwave oven so as to absorb high frequency leaks, so that the installation of the high frequency absorber is simple and a considerable raw material cost can be reduced.

일반적으로 전자렌지의 조리실에는 마그네트론을 설치하여 고주파를 발생하도록 구성한 것인데, 주로 전장실의 저면판에 취부된 고압트랜스의 1차 및 2차 유도코일이 상호 유도작용에 의해 생성된 고전압을 안정적으로 인가함에 따라 마그네트론이 고주파를 생성하게 된다.In general, microwave ovens are equipped with magnetrons to generate high frequency. The primary and secondary induction coils of the high voltage transformer mounted on the bottom plate of the electric room are stably applied with the high voltage generated by mutual induction. As a result, the magnetron generates high frequencies.

상기와 같이 마그네트론에서 생성된 고주파는 도파관을 통해서 조리실 내부로 조사(照射)토록 하므로서 조리실 내부에 놓여진 음식물이 조리되도록 한 것인데, 주로 조리실 입구에는 도어를 설치하여 조리시 발생되는 고주파를 효과적으로 밀폐토록 한 것이다.As described above, the high frequency generated by the magnetron allows the food placed inside the cooking chamber to be cooked by irradiating the inside of the cooking chamber through the waveguide. will be.

그런데 전자렌지의 전면에 설치되며 조리실을 개폐하도록 취부되는 도어에는 별도의 고주파 흡수체를 설치하여 고주파가 누설되는 것을 효과적으로 방지토록 구성하였는데, 종래에는 제3도에서 도시한 바와같이 도어프레임(10) 내부에 설치되는 도어플레이트(11)와 도어스크린(12) 사이에 개구부(21)를 형성하고 상기한 개구부(21) 사이에는 고주파 흡수체(20)를 끼워 설치하므로서 누설되는 고주파를 흡수토록 한 것이다.By the way, the front door of the microwave oven is installed to open and close the cooking chamber to install a separate high-frequency absorber to effectively prevent the high-frequency leakage, conventionally as shown in Figure 3 inside the door frame 10 An opening 21 is formed between the door plate 11 and the door screen 12 to be installed in the upper plate 21, and the high frequency absorber 20 is inserted between the openings 21 so as to absorb high frequency leaks.

상기한 고주파 흡수체(20)는 고주파 흡수성이 좋은 페라이트와 접착제를 혼합한 재질을 사출성형하여 도어플레이트(11)와 도어스크린(12) 사이의 개구부(21)에 탄발 삽지되도록 한 것이나, 이와같은 종래의 기술 구성은 상당한 문제점이 있는 것인바 이를 상세히 설명하면 다음과 같다.The high frequency absorber 20 is injection molding a material mixed with a ferrite and an adhesive having good high frequency absorption so as to be inserted into the opening 21 between the door plate 11 and the door screen 12. The technical configuration of the is that there is a significant problem described in detail as follows.

첫째; 상기한 고주파 흡수체(20)는 사출 성형하는 방식으로 형성하는 것이기 때문에 이에 따르는 별도의 사출 금형을 제작하는데 막대한 제작비가 소요되는 문제점이 있는 것이고, 이러한 사출 금형은 보수 유지비 또한 상당하게 소요되는 폐단이 있는 것이다.first; Since the high frequency absorber 20 is formed by injection molding, there is a problem in that a huge manufacturing cost is required to manufacture a separate injection mold according to this, and such an injection mold has a closed end that requires considerable maintenance costs. will be.

둘째; 상기와 같은 고주파 흡수체(20)는 전자렌지의 기종마다 외형 및 사이즈(size)가 다르게 형성되어 있는 것인바 기종별로 별도의 금형을 제작함에 따르는 경제적 손실 및 기종별 금형관리가 상당히 어려운 점이 있다.second; The high-frequency absorber 20 as described above is that the appearance and size (size) is formed differently for each type of microwave oven, there is a point that the economic loss and mold management for each type is quite difficult to produce a separate mold for each type.

세째; 고주파 흡수체(20)를 형성할때 페라이트와 접착제를 혼합한 재질을 사용하여 사출 성형한 것인바 재질의 특성상 쉽게 부러지는 성질이 있는 것이기 때문에 겨울철같이 주변의 온도가 낮게 분포되었을때는 고주파 흡수체(20)를 개구부(21)에 탄발 삽지시키거나 수리를 위하여 개구부(21)에서 분리할 경우에 고주파 흡수체(20)가 쉽게 부러지는 폐단이 있는 것이다.Third; When the high frequency absorber 20 is formed by injection molding using a mixture of ferrite and an adhesive, it is easily broken due to the characteristics of the material. Therefore, when the ambient temperature is distributed low in winter, the high frequency absorber 20 is used. Is inserted into the opening 21, or when the high frequency absorber 20 is easily broken when the separation from the opening 21 for repair is there is a closed end.

따라서 본 발명의 목적은 고주파 흡수체의 제작비가 적게 소요되는 동시에 설치가 간편하여 손망실이 발생하지 않는 전자렌지용 도어의 고주파 누설방지 구조를 제공하는데 있다.Accordingly, an object of the present invention is to provide a high frequency leakage prevention structure of a microwave oven door, which is easy to install due to the low manufacturing cost of the high frequency absorber.

즉, 본 발명은 도어프레임(10) 내부에 설치되는 도어플레이트(11)와 도어스크린(12) 사이의 개구부(21)에 고주파 흡수체를 삽지시킨 도어에 있어서 도어플레이트(11)에 절곡부(11a)를 연장 형성하여 개구부(21)가 막혀지게 하고 도어스크린(12)의 외주연에는 홈부(22)를 절곡 형성한 후 이에 페라이트와 수지를 혼합한 액상의 고주파 흡수체(20)를 함입시킨 것이다.That is, the present invention is a bent portion (11a) in the door plate 11 in the door in which the high frequency absorber is inserted into the opening 21 between the door plate 11 and the door screen 12 installed inside the door frame 10 ) Is formed so that the opening 21 is blocked and the groove 22 is bent at the outer periphery of the door screen 12, and then the liquid high frequency absorber 20 mixed with ferrite and resin is embedded therein.

도면중 미설명 부호(13)은 도어스크린(12)에 부착되는 내측판이고, (30)은 전장실이다.In the figure, reference numeral 13 denotes an inner plate attached to the door screen 12, and 30 denotes an electric compartment.

이와같이 형성된 본 발명은 종래와 같이 별도로 사출 성형된 고주파 흡수체(20)를 개구부(21)에 삽지시키는 것이 아니라 도어스크린(12)의 외주연에 절곡 형성된 홈부(22)에 페라이트와 수지를 혼합시킨 고주파 흡수체(20)를 함입시킨후 건조시키기만 하면 고주파 흡수체(20)가 홈부(22)에 안정적으로 유지되는 것인바 고주파 흡수체(20)가 부러지거나 손망실되는 종래의 폐단이 방지되는 것이고, 별도의 사출 금형을 제작할 필요가 없는 것이다.The present invention thus formed does not insert the high-frequency absorber 20 separately injection-molded in the opening 21 as in the prior art, but the high frequency in which ferrite and resin are mixed in the groove part 22 bent at the outer periphery of the door screen 12. Once the absorbent body 20 is inserted and dried, the high frequency absorber 20 is stably maintained in the groove 22. Thus, the conventional closed end of the high frequency absorber 20 that is broken or lost is prevented. There is no need to make an injection mold.

따라서 상기한 바와같이 금형을 별도로 제작할 필요가 없는 본 발명은 고주파 흡수체(20)의 제조단가를 상당히 낮출 수 있는 것이므로 전체적인 전자렌지의 제작비를 절감시킬 수 있는 것이며, 전자렌지의 기종에 관계없이 도어스크린(12)의 주연홈부(22)에 고주파 흡수체(20)를 함입시키는 것인바 고주파 흡수체(20)의 설치가 매우 간편해진 것이다.Therefore, the present invention, which does not need to separately manufacture a mold as described above, can significantly reduce the manufacturing cost of the high frequency absorber 20, thereby reducing the overall manufacturing cost of the microwave oven, regardless of the model of the microwave oven. Since the high frequency absorber 20 is embedded in the peripheral groove portion 22 of 12, the installation of the high frequency absorber 20 becomes very simple.

그리고 고주파 흡수체(20)는 주로 고주파에 대해 흡수성이 뛰어난 페라이트와 수지를 혼합한 액상의 재질로 형성한 것인데, 이는 도어스크린(12)에 형성된 홈부(22)에 고주파 흡수체(20)를 용이하게 함입시키기 위함이다.In addition, the high frequency absorber 20 is mainly formed of a liquid material in which ferrite and resin are excellent in absorbing high frequency, which is easily incorporated into the groove 22 formed in the door screen 12. To do so.

상기한 도어플레이트(11)의 절곡부(11a)를 연장 형성토록 하여 고주파 흡수체(20)가 삽지되는 개구부(21)가 막혀지게 하므로서 필요가 없게 된 개구부(21)를 차폐하여 고주파가 누설되는 것을 효과적으로 방지할 수 있도록 한 것이다.The opening part 21 of the door plate 11 is extended to be formed so that the opening part 21 into which the high frequency absorber 20 is inserted is blocked, thereby shielding the opening part 21 which is not necessary to leak the high frequency wave. It is to prevent effectively.

이상에서 상술한 바와같은 본 발명은 도어스크린(12)이 주연부에 절곡 형성된 홈부(22)에 액상의 고주파 흡수체(20)를 함입시키기만 하면 조리실(30)에서 발생되는 고주파의 누설을 효과적으로 차단시킬 수 있는 것인바 별도의 금형을 제작하는데 소요되는 제작비를 절감시킬 뿐만 아니라 고주파 흡수체(20)가 부러지는 등의 손망실을 방지할 수 있는 유용한 발명인 것이다.As described above, the present invention can effectively block the high frequency leakage generated in the cooking chamber 30 by simply injecting the liquid high frequency absorber 20 into the groove 22 formed at the periphery of the door screen 12. It will be a useful invention that can not only reduce the manufacturing cost required to manufacture a separate mold, but also prevent the loss of high frequency absorber 20, such as broken.
